New Issue: HSBC prices $4.5 million buffered AMPS due 2018 linked to S&P 500
By Susanna Moon
Chicago, Sept. 18 – HSBC USA Inc. priced $4.5 million of 0% buffered Accelerated Market Participation Securities due Sept. 20, 2017 linked to the S&P 500 index, according to a 424B2 fil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.
The payout at maturity will be par plus double the index return, up to a maximum return of 20.25%.
Investors will receive par if the index falls by up to 15% and will lose 1.1765% for every 1% decline beyond 15%.
HSBC Securities (USA) Inc. is the agent.
